  • Cowboy BeBop at His Computer: The back of Manga Entertainment's DVD release calls it the "pulse-pounding sequel to the popular Street Fighter II V series." The two works aren't even in the same continuity, and even if they were, it would be a prequel given the games themselves.
  • Late Export for You: Latin America never saw an official release until 2020, when it was added without any kind of warning to Amazon Prime Video with a brand new dub.

  • The Other Darrin:
    • Ken and Zangief have different voice actors in comparison to their previous appearances. In The Animated Movie, Ken was voiced by Eddie Frierson, while Zangief was voiced by Michael Sorich. In the Manga dub of II V, Ken was voiced by Stephen Apostolina, while Zangief was voiced by the late Kevin Seymour. Here, Ken is voiced by Steve Blum, while Zangief is voiced by Joe Romersa.
    • In The Animated Movie, Gouken was voiced by Michael Forest. In this movie, he is voiced by Simon Prescott.
  • You Sound Familiar:
    • Both Ken's and Zangief's voices were in the other two works as well. Steve Blum voiced T. Hawk in the former and Dhalsim in the latter. Romersa voiced Balrog in both works.
    • Tom Wyner had previously provided the voice of M. Bison in both of the previous works.
    • Bob Papenbrook was present in II V as the voice of Nucchi before voicing Dan in this movie.
